About Minnesota Virtual Academy Middle
Minnesota Virtual Academy Middle is a public middle school in Houston, MN, part of Houston Public School District, serving approximately 341 students in grades 6th-8th with a 12.6:1 student-teacher ratio. It holds a MySchoolScout rating of 5.5 out of 10 and ranks #1,383 of 1,992 schools in MN. State assessment records show 23% math proficiency (2022 EdFacts) and 49% reading/ELA proficiency (2022 EdFacts).
